目录
- 引言
- 什么是VPN
- 自己搭建VPN的必要性
- 自己搭建VPN的优缺点
- 优点
- 缺点
- 如何搭建VPN
- 选择VPN协议
- 安装VPN软件
- 配置服务器
- 自己搭建VPN的安全性分析
- 数据加密
- 访问控制
- 安全漏洞
- 常见问题解答
- 结论
1. 引言
随着网络安全问题的日益严重,越来越多的人开始关注VPN(虚拟私人网络)的使用。通过VPN,可以保护用户的隐私,防止数据泄露。然而,很多用户在选择VPN服务时面临诸多选择,不知道是使用公共VPN还是自己搭建VPN。本篇文章将全面探讨自己搭建VPN的安全性。
2. 什么是VPN
VPN,即虚拟私人网络,是通过在公共网络上创建一个安全的加密连接,使用户能够安全地访问互联网。它能够隐藏用户的真实IP地址,加密用户的上网数据,从而保护用户的隐私。
3. 自己搭建VPN的必要性
自己搭建VPN可以满足用户对隐私和安全的特定需求,尤其是在以下几种情况下:
- 对隐私要求高:如果你非常重视个人隐私,自建VPN可以避免将数据交给第三方服务提供商。
- 控制性强:通过自己搭建VPN,你可以完全控制服务器的设置和配置,确保安全性。
- 避免审查:在某些国家或地区,自建VPN可以帮助绕过网络审查,访问被封锁的网站。
4. 自己搭建VPN的优缺点
优点
- 数据隐私:所有数据流量仅在你的服务器和终端设备之间传输,避免了数据泄露的风险。
- 灵活性:可以根据需求自定义VPN设置,包括加密强度、连接协议等。
- 经济性:长期来看,自建VPN可能比订阅付费VPN服务更加经济。
缺点
- 技术门槛:搭建VPN需要一定的技术知识,对普通用户而言可能存在挑战。
- 维护成本:自己维护服务器需要时间和精力,尤其是确保服务器的安全和稳定运行。
- 安全风险:如果配置不当,可能会造成安全漏洞,反而增加安全风险。
5. 如何搭建VPN
搭建VPN通常包括以下几个步骤:
选择VPN协议
- OpenVPN:被广泛使用,安全性高,支持多种平台。
- L2TP/IPsec:结合了L2TP协议和IPsec加密,安全性也较高。
- PPTP:虽然搭建简单,但安全性较低,不推荐使用。
安装VPN软件
- 选择适合自己操作系统的VPN服务器软件,如OpenVPN、SoftEther等。
- 按照官方文档进行安装和配置。
配置服务器
- 配置防火墙规则,确保只允许VPN流量通过。
- 配置用户访问权限和认证方式,确保只有授权用户才能连接。
6. 自己搭建VPN的安全性分析
数据加密
自建VPN的一个重要安全特性是数据加密。通过使用强加密算法(如AES-256),可以有效保护用户的上网数据不被窃取。
访问控制
确保只有授权用户才能连接VPN,这是保护服务器安全的关键措施。可以通过设置用户名和密码,或者使用更高级的认证方式(如证书认证)来实现。
安全漏洞
自建VPN的安全性取决于用户的配置和管理。若配置不当,可能会导致安全漏洞,例如:
- 未加密的连接:如使用不安全的协议,数据易被窃听。
- 默认设置:许多软件在安装后默认设置不安全,用户需及时调整。
7. 常见问题解答
Q1: 自己搭建VPN安全吗?
A: 自己搭建VPN的安全性取决于配置和管理。如果正确设置并定期更新,安全性可以很高。但如果设置不当,可能会引入安全风险。
Q2: 自建VPN和使用公共VPN相比,哪个更安全?
A: 自建VPN一般被认为比公共VPN更安全,因为你掌握了所有数据,避免了第三方服务商可能的数据泄露问题。
Q3: 自建VPN需要多少技术知识?
A: 搭建VPN需要一定的网络和服务器知识,但许多开源软件都有详细的文档和教程,可以帮助用户完成搭建。
Q4: 如何确保自建VPN的安全性?
A: 确保使用强加密协议,定期更新软件和补丁,配置用户访问权限,及时监控服务器日志等。
8. 结论
综上所述,自己搭建VPN是一个可以有效保护用户隐私和数据安全的选择,但同时也伴随着一定的技术挑战和安全风险。用户需要根据自身的需求和能力做出明智的选择。如果选择自建VPN,务必注重安全配置和日常维护。